Addressing Frown Lines & Forehead Wrinkles: Targeted Treatment Options
Those noticeable lines between your eyebrows, often called frown lines, and the transverse wrinkles across your forehead, are common signs of aging. Fortunately, a selection of powerful treatment options are offered to reduce their appearance and restore a more youthful complexion. Non-invasive solutions might feature topical creams containing ingredients like retinoids or peptides, which assist skin firmness. For significant concerns, professional treatments such as Botox, dermal fillers, or laser resurfacing may be suggested by a qualified aesthetic physician. Ultimately, opting for the right approach depends on your specific concerns and complexion, so a thorough consultation is crucial to determine the most appropriate course of action.

As we progress gracefully, the upper face often exhibits the earliest signs of years's passage: horizontal forehead lines, a drooping brow, and a general feeling of heaviness. While a classic brow lift can significantly refine the appearance by raising the upper lids and smoothing forehead wrinkles, modern aesthetics offers even more options. These can include localized Botox injections to relax muscles and diminish dynamic wrinkles, dermal fillers to restore lost volume and lift the brow tail, or even thread lifts for a gentle non-surgical lift. A comprehensive consultation with a qualified expert is crucial to identify the most appropriate treatment plan and achieve a natural-looking, rejuvenated result.
